Understanding Vanuatu’s Citizenship by Investment Program

Vanuatu’s Citizenship by Investment Program was established in 2017 and offers a fast-track option for investors and their families. The program allows foreign nationals to acquire citizenship by making a significant investment in the country. This investment typically goes to the Development Support Program (DSP), which helps fund crucial infrastructure and other national development projects. The citizenship acquired through this program allows investors to enjoy various benefits, including the right to live and work in Vanuatu, travel to over 130 countries without a visa, and potential tax advantages.

Cost Breakdown of the Vanuatu Citizenship by Investment Program

The process of obtaining Vanuatu citizenship is straightforward but involves several costs beyond the initial investment. Below are the major costs involved in the application process:

1. Contribution to the Development Support Program (DSP)

The primary investment required is a contribution to the DSP. As of 2024, the minimum amount for a primary applicant is approximately $130,000. This amount may vary based on the size of the family, where additional contributions are required for dependents.

2. Due Diligence Fees

An essential part of the application process is the due diligence checks undertaken by the government to ensure the integrity and background of the applicants. These fees are generally around $5,000 per applicant and are non-refundable. This process helps maintain the program’s credibility and ensures only trustworthy individuals obtain citizenship.

3. Processing Fees

Processing fees must also be accounted for. For a principal applicant, this fee is usually around $2,000. Additional fees may apply for each dependent applying alongside the primary applicant.

4. Legal and Agency Fees

Engaging a registered agent or lawyer to assist with the application is highly recommended. The cost for their services can range from $5,000 to $10,000, depending on the complexity of the application and the reputation of the service provider.

5. Additional Costs

Applicants should also consider additional costs that may arise, such as obtaining necessary documents, translation services, and travel expenses. Although these are not fixed, they can add up depending on the individual circumstances of the applicant.

Benefits of Vanuatu Citizenship

The advantages of holding Vanuatu citizenship extend beyond travel benefits. Some notable perks include:

  • Visa-free access to over 130 countries, including the Schengen Area, the UK, and Russia.
  • Tax benefits: No capital gains tax, no inheritance tax, and no personal income tax are levied.
  • Peaceful and stable living environment in a tropical paradise.
  • Opportunity to conduct business and invest in a growing economy without restrictions.

The Application Process

The application process for Vanuatu citizenship by investment is designed to be efficient. Typically, the entire process can be completed within a few months. Prospective applicants need to provide various documents, including proof of investment, identification documents, and health clearance.
